The Electronic Equipment Trades Worker is a key technical role responsible for the installation, testing, diagnosis, repair, and maintenance of a wide range of electrical and electronic appliances. The ideal candidate will possess solid technical skills, meticulous attention to detail, and a commitment to maintaining high standards of workmanship. This role involves both workshop-based repairs and on-site customer support, ensuring all products meet operational and safety standards before resale and that customers receive excellent technical assistance.
Job Responsibility:
Installing, testing and commissioning household electrical appliances and consumer electronic equipment
Diagnosing faults in electrical, electronic and mechanical components using test instruments and technical manuals
Repairing, replacing and calibrating parts such as compressors, circuit boards, wiring, switches and motors
Performing preventive maintenance and quality assurance checks on refurbished and clearance appliances prior to resale
Assembling and disassembling appliances to identify issues and restore to operational condition
Providing after-sales service, technical support and on-site repairs to customers
Advising customers on proper operation, care and safe use of appliances and equipment
Maintaining accurate service logs, warranty records and repair documentation
